#d53047 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d53047 is composed of 83.5% red, 18.8%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.5% magenta, 66.7%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 351.6 degrees, a saturation of 66.3% and a lightness of 51.2%. #d53047 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ff608e with #ab0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#d53047 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d53047 has RGB values of R:213, G:48,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.67,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13971527.

Shades and Tints of #d53047

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050102 is the darkest color, while #fdf4f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d53047

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#887d7e is the less saturated color, while #fb0a2b is the most saturated one.
